IDC PREP: Preparation
Start your Instructor Development Course online

There are a couple of things you could prepare in advance before your IDC starts. You can either refresh your theory knowledge using the "PADI Diving Knowledge Workbook" and the "PADI Encyclopedia" or you logg on to the PAD webpage eLearning section and choose to study the "dive theory" online.

Apart from studying the dive theory online you can as well start the following IDC sections online using the PADI webpage:

  1. Learning, Instruction and the PADI System
  2. General Standards and Procedures
  3. Risk Management
  4. Marketing Diving
  5. Start Diving
  6. Teaching PADI Specialty Diver Courses
  7. Business of Diving
  8. Keep Diving
  9. How to Teach the Recreational Dive Planner (RDP) – required for crossover candidates; optional for PADI Members
You can complete those independent learning sections online through PADI eLearning, or as well participate in these sections during your IDC.
 
If you arrive at your IDC location a few days in advanced or have the possibility somewhere else to join a PADI Instructor during an Open Water Course, this is another good way to get prepared.

Jump in a pool, a lake or the sea with a buddy and practice the demonstration of all skills out of the PADI Open Water Diver Course as you did during your Divemaster Training Course. Remember that your demo should be slow, exaggerating and easy looking.
